    Father`s Day Gift Guide


    (Page 1 of 4 )

    I hope my Mother's Day gift guide helped you pick the perfect Mother's Day gift. As you know, or at least you should know, Father's Day is coming up quickly. Do you have a great gift in mind? Not yet? Don't worry, I'll give you some ideas; hopefully, they'll help you find the gift that's perfect for your dad. Fathers tend to like tech gadgets more than mothers do, so you probably can't go wrong with a new tech toy.

    TVs

    Almost all fathers love to watch TV; what could be better than a nice new TV?  There are thousands of different TVs out there, so how do you know which one to pick? It's hard; it mostly depends on your price range and what you're looking for. I personally love Samsung TVs, but make sure you check the reviews for the TV before buying any brand. 

    I would look at the Samsung LN-4665F. It is a very popular TV. It sports a very nice 46 inch LCD screen with all the connections you would need. I personally have a Samsung SlimFit 27 inch HDTV. It's a very good bargain when compared to the competition. It has a wonderfully clear picture, lots of connections and a modest price tag. The only real down side I know of is that it weights a lot.  My father and I can barely move it. 

    PDA or PDA/Cell Phone Combo

    If your father is a business man, he probably has important meetings, critical emails and important documents.  What better way to help your father than by getting him a PDA? With both Palm and Windows Mobile, you can keep track of everything. 

    PDAs are a dying breed; most of them have turned into cell phone hybrids. HP still makes stand alone PDAs, but most of them are going to be found in cell phone stores. The great part about having it built into your cell phone is that you can use the cell phone connection to get onto the Internet and have to carry around only one device rather than a PDA and a cell phone. 

    Check what your current cell phone carrier has to offer. There are many new phones coming out this summer. With the launch of the iPhone, many companies are giving their PDA phones an update to help hold their market share. If you don't want to wait until the new ones are launched, look at the current ones -- they should be going on sale soon to make way for new inventory.

    Remote

    If you house is like mine, you have quite a few remotes lying around.  It takes at least two or three to go from the TV to a DVD.  Logitech's Harmony remote is your answer.  It is a single remote that can take on the functions from all your remotes simultaneously. This is a great gift that your dad probably wouldn't think of if you want to surprise him.  This is what I may get my father for Father's Day.  He is always picking up remotes and putting them either on the TV, the cable box or the coffee table.  It's a scavenger hunt trying to find them just to watch a movie.  With this device, there will be only one remote to find.
